Mobile Story Walk

The Great Start Family Coalition has a variety of mobile Story Walks available free to non-profits and educational institutions. 

Story Walk lengths vary, with the maximum being 16 placards long. Each placard is 3 1/2 feet tall by 2 feet wide. They are lightweight with aluminum frames. The number of placards borrowed will depend on the length of the story you choose. The borrower is responsible for picking up and returning the Story Walk. 

Books available include: 

  • Bugs A-Z
  • Fish Eyes
  • Let's Go Bikes 
  • Bee Dance 
  • Hey Coach 
  • Farm Animals 
  • Belly Breathe 
  • Be Who You Are 
  • Gardens are for Growing 
  • Five Little Ducks
  • It's Okay to be Different

Literacy Essentials

The General Education Leadership Network (GELN) has created Essential Instructional Practices in Language and Emergent Literacy to help foster literacy in Michigan.  They have literacy resources for birth to though grade 12 on their website at LiteracyEssentials.org.
 

 

Talking is Teaching

Talking, singing, and reading to your child can help build their brain and develop the social-emotional skills that they need.  Talking is Teaching's website, TalkingisTeaching.org, is continually updated with free, fun activities designed to help your child grow. Resources are available in both English and Spanish.

Zero to Three

Zero to Three has resources for parents and grandparents to support them in promoting their children's growth and development.  Resources are available in both English and Spanish at Zerotothree.org.

If you see or hear something that doesn’t seem right, you can submit a confidential tip to OK2SAY. OK2SAY allows anyone to confidentially report tips on criminal activities or potential harm directed at Michigan students, school employees, or schools. Protect yourself and others by using OK2SAY.
